The following supplemental documentation can be uploaded in the online application.

  • High School Transcript (if currently in Grade 9-11) or Final Report Card (if currently in Grade 8).
  • Recommendation Form (completed by Principal or Vice-Principal)
  • Applicant’s standardized test scores
  • Applicant’s discipline and attendance records from previous school(s)

At this point, Bass Memorial Academy will make our Admissions Decision and if accepted, you will receive an official letter of acceptance.

Once you are officially accepted start step number 3.

*Before the application is taken to the Admissions Committee, the Recruitment office must receive these.

All students must have the following on file at BMA on or before registration day:

• An up-to-date immunization certificate (see the Admissions section of the BMA Handbook for details). Students who don’t have all the necessary immunizations by the start of school will be required to visit the Mississippi Public Health Department within the first month of school to get the required immunizations. The Public Health Department charges for each vaccination given.
• A report of a recent (within one year) physical examination
• I-9 form – Employment Eligibility Verification
• W-4 form – Employee’s Withholding Certificate
• Copy of applicant’s medical insurance
• Copy of applicant’s social security card
• Copy of applicant’s birth certificate
